How much do crystal report developer jobs pay per hour?

As of Jul 5, 2026, the average hourly pay for crystal report developer in Colorado is $58.56,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$36.15 and $80.87 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the Crystal Report Developer position,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Crystal Report Developer, you need a solid background in SQL, report design, and database management, often supported by a degree in computer science or a related field. Familiarity with Crystal Reports, various database systems (such as SQL Server or Oracle), and potentially relevant certifications like SAP Crystal Reports Certified Application Associate are typical requirements. Strong analytical thinking, attention to detail, and effective communication are valuable soft skills in this role. These competencies enable accurate data analysis, clear reporting, and successful collaboration with stakeholders to meet business needs.

What are the typical daily tasks and responsibilities of a Crystal Report Developer?

A Crystal Report Developer typically spends their day gathering requirements from business users, designing and developing interactive reports, and validating report data for accuracy. They often collaborate with database administrators, business analysts, and end users to ensure reports meet organizational needs and provide actionable insights. Troubleshooting reporting issues, optimizing query performance, and maintaining documentation are also key parts of the job. Developers may work independently or as part of a larger IT or BI team, depending on the organization's size and structure.

What is a Crystal Report Developer job?

A Crystal Report Developer is responsible for designing, developing, and maintaining reports using SAP Crystal Reports. They work with databases to extract, analyze, and present data in a structured format for business decision-making. Their role includes writing SQL queries, optimizing report performance, and troubleshooting report-related issues. Additionally, they collaborate with business users to gather requirements and ensure reports meet organizational needs.

Job description

Job Summary:
Colas USA is one of North America’s largest road and infrastructure groups, and they are seeking a Senior Power BI Developer to design and own their enterprise semantic layer. This role involves delivering high-impact reporting for the Enterprise Reporting & Data Warehouse platform, optimizing data models, and mentoring team members.
Responsibilities:
• Design, build, and own enterprise-grade semantic data models (dimensional / star-schema) that serve as long-lived, reusable IP for the organization.
• Develop and optimize advanced DAX measures and calculation logic—including time intelligence and calculation groups—for correctness and performance.
• Design, develop, and deploy interactive Power BI reports and dashboards that communicate insights clearly to business stakeholders.
• Apply data-visualization and UX best practices—including accessibility (WCAG) and mobile / responsive design—so reports are intuitive, consistent, and performant.
• Build paginated, print-ready reports using Power BI Report Builder and Power BI Report Server (PBIRS)—leveraging Power BI semantic models through XMLA endpoints, DAX, and shared dataset-based reporting for operational and financial reporting.
• Manage Power BI development using the Power BI Project (PBIP) format under source control, and build and maintain CI/CD for Power BI—Git-integrated workspaces, deployment pipelines, and automated validation—to promote content reliably from development to test to production.
• Optimize model and report performance (VertiPaq analysis, query folding, aggregations, incremental refresh, composite models, and DAX tuning).
• Implement row-level and object-level security (RLS / OLS), sensitivity labels, and endorsements (certified / promoted datasets) to protect data and build trust in reports.
• Partner with data engineering to source and shape data from Databricks, Microsoft Fabric, and other sources (Power Query / M) and validate data quality.
• Manage and govern the Power BI Service—workspaces, datasets, deployment pipelines, scheduled refreshes, capacity / Premium, and usage monitoring.
• Contribute to the BI / analytics roadmap and define enterprise semantic-model and reporting standards, reusable patterns, and best practices.
• Mentor developers and coach citizen developers; collaborate with product owners, business analysts, and stakeholders to translate requirements and KPIs into effective BI solutions.
• Document semantic models, data lineage, and report design; provide user training and support.
• Leverage AI-assisted tools to accelerate model and report development, documentation, and testing while validating outcomes.
